DVD (Digital Versatile Disc) is an optical storage technology developed in the mid-1990s to store digital video, audio, and data. Created through collaboration between major global electronics and media companies, the format was standardized by the DVD Forum to ensure compatibility across devices. DVDs offered significantly higher storage capacity than CDs, enabling high-quality video playback and interactive features such as menus and subtitles. The technology became the dominant home entertainment medium in the late 1990s and 2000s, widely used for movies, software distribution, and data backup. Although later surpassed by Blu-ray discs and digital streaming services, DVD remains supported by many devices and continues to be used worldwide.
